1. Classic Curly Crop

- This timeless haircut keeps curls short and neat while highlighting their natural bounce.
- It is perfect for active toddlers who need a low-maintenance style.
- The sides are trimmed while curls remain slightly longer on top for volume.
2. Curly Fringe Style

- This haircut features soft curls falling over the forehead.
- It adds a playful and youthful look to toddlers.
- The sides are kept short to balance the front fringe.
3. Tapered Curly Cut

- This style blends longer curls on top with gradually shorter sides.
- It gives a clean yet stylish appearance.
- Ideal for parents who want a polished look without losing curl texture.
4. Curly Mohawk

- This bold haircut keeps curls concentrated in the center.
- The sides are trimmed short or faded.
- It creates a fun and edgy look for toddlers.
5. Natural Long Curls

- This style allows curls to grow freely with minimal trimming.
- It showcases the natural beauty of curly hair.
- Requires regular detangling and moisturizing.
